With a virtual front-row concept for fashion shows being the norm for the past year, well-known celebrities from around the world tuned in for Burberry’s AW 21 presentation this week wearing edited looks from the new collection.

The guest list ranged from the likes of supermodels Naomi Campbell, Gigi Hadid and Kendall Jenner to the performance artist Marina Abramović and many more, with British rapper Shygirl kickstarting the show.

The vast star-cast collection joined the digital presentation, with the supermodel Gigi Hadid styled as a pink fluffy Burberry bunny as she added a softer nod to the brand’s AW 21 theme.

Meanwhile, Naomi Campbell was adorned in well-structured tailored black cigarette pants accompanied with the classic Burberry trench and Kendall Jenner and Irina Shayk presented themselves in luxe black Burberry leather as they captured Tisci’s vision through their own flair.

There were many other celebrities who joined in front-row (virtually) including Jessica Chastain, Madonna, Lila Moss, Katy England, Diana Silvers and more.

With bold, confident silhouettes and accessories presented, Riccardo Tisci’s presentation was an ode to femininity as the collection was emblematic of women empowerment through flawlessly designed pieces.

Tisci, Burberry’s Chief Creative Officer said, “I wanted this collection to feel truly emblematic of the power of feminine energy: a modern armour that captures its characteristic fierce aura.

“There’s an underlying attitude to the collection that’s very British; of being unique, eccentric and totally authentic in how you express yourself.”

While emulating encouraging freedom of expression through the show, the theme focused on a love letter to women and a celebration of their strength as it was showcased in the Maison’s 121 Regent store with an eclectic spirit displayed through each look, such as the stretch-tulle sculptural heels and the gleaming gold lamé pieces.
